LONDON SCHOOL OF SAMBA
Charity overview
Activities - how the charity spends its money
The London School of Samba aims to advance education through the promotion of the arts with particular reference to samba music and dance and the culture and tradition of Afro-Brazilian Carnival. The main activities include: open access workshops to teach Brazilian dance and drumming, public performances, participation at major events, outreach work, costume design and float building.
